CALCIUM NITRATE
Chemical Designations - Synonyms: Calcium Nitrate Tetrahydrate; Chemical Formula:
Ca(N03),.41.1,,0.
Observable Characteristics - Physical State (as nonnally shipped): Solid; Color: White; Odor: None.
Physical and Chemical Properties - Physical State at 15 SC and I atm. : Solid; Molecular Weight:
164; Boiling Point at 1 am. : Decomposes; Freezing Point: 1.042,561,934; Critical Temperature: Not
pertinent; Critical Pressure: Not pertinent; Specijic Gravity: 2.50 at 18 "C (solid); Vapor (Gas)
Density: Not pertinent; Ratio of Specific Heats of Vapor (Gas): Not pertinent; Latent Heat of
Vaporization: Not pertinent; Heat of Combustion: Not pertinent; Heat ofDecomposition: Not pertinent.
Health Hazards Information - Recommended Personal Protective Equipment: Dust respirator and
rubber gloves; Symptoms Following Enposure: Dust causes mild irritation of eyes; General Treatment
for Exposure: EYES or SKIN: flush with water; Toxicity by Inhalation (Threshold Limit Value): Data
not available; Short-Term Exposure Limits: Data not available; Toxicity by Ingestion: Data not available;
Late Toxicity: None; Vapor (Gas) Irritant Characteristics: Not pertinent; Liquid or Solid Irritant
characteristics: Data not available; Odor Threshold Not pertinent.
Fire Hazards - Flash Point: Not flammable however may cause fires when in contact with flammables;
Flammable Limits in Air (5%): Not flammable; Fire Extinguishing Agents: Flood with water; Fire
Extinguishing Agents Not To Be Used Not pertinent; Special Hazards of Combustion Products:
Produces toxic oxides of nitrogen when involved in fires; Behavior in Fire: Can greatly intensify the
burning of all combustible materials; Ignition Temperature: Not pertinent; Electrical Hazard Not
pertinent; Burning Rate: Not pertinent.
Chemical Reactivity -Reactivity with Water: No reaction; Reactivity with Common Materials: Contact
with combustible materials can result in fires; Stability During Transpoti: Stable; Neutralizing Agents
for Acids and Caustics: Not pertinent; Polymerization: Not pertinent; Inhibitor of Polymerization: Not
pertinent.
CALCIUM OXIDE
Chemical Designations - Synonyms: Quicklime; Unslaked Lime; Chemical Formula: CaO.
Observable Characteristics - Physical State (as normally shipped) : Solid; Color: White yo grey; Odor:
Odorless.
Physical and Chemical Properties - Physical State at 15 "c and I am. : Solid; Molecular Weight
56.08; Boiling Point at I atm.: Not pertinent; Freezing Point; Not pertinent; Critical Temperature: Not
pertinent; Critical Pressure: Not pertinent; Specijic Gravity: 3.3 at 20°C (solid); Vapor (Gas) Density:
Not pertinent; Ratio of Spec@c Heats of Vapor (Gas): Not pertinent; Latent Heat of Vaporization: Not
pertinent; Heat of Combustion: Not pertinent; Heat of Decomposition: Not pertinent.
Health Hazards Information - Recommended Personal Protective Equipment: Protective gloves,
goggles, and any type of respirator prescribed for fine dust; Symptoms Following Exposure: Cause
burns on mucous membrane and skin. Inhalation of dust causes sneezing; General Treatment for
Exposure: INGESTION if victim is conscious, have him drink water or milk. Do NOT induce
vomiting. SKIN and EYES: flush with water and seek medical help; Toxicity by Inhalation (Threshold
Limit Value): 5 mg/m3; Short-Term Exposure Limits: 10 mg/m3 for 30 min; Toxicity by Ingestion: Data
not available; Late Toxicity: None; Vapor (Gas) Imhnt Chamcteristics: Not pertinent; Liquid or Solid
Irritant Characteristics: Causes smarting of the skin and first-degree burns on short exposure and may
cause secondary burns on long exposure; Odor Threshold: Not pertinent.
Fire Hazards - Flash Point: Not flammable; Flammable Limits in Air (W): Not flammable; Fire
Extinguishing Agents: Not pertinent; Fire Extinguishing Agents Not To Be Used Do not use water on
adjacent fires; @ecial Hazards of Combustion Products: Not pertinent; Behavior in Fire: Not pertinent;
Ignition Temperature: Not flammable; Electrical Hazard Not pertinent; Burning Rate: Not pertinent.
